Output 59ad02411d716ab73611520a6796f5c25cf30b83cd077b8f4fc3846121bd6417:0

value
146853
script pubkey
OP_0 OP_PUSHBYTES_20 6d76191e2952797de32cd6c2984dfa9bb7fb26dc
address
bc1qd4mpj83f2fuhmcev6mpfsn06nwmlkfkusqcdqt
transaction
59ad02411d716ab73611520a6796f5c25cf30b83cd077b8f4fc3846121bd6417
confirmations
3576
spent
true